Although the current power grid enterprises have established emergency plans for a variety of disasters and large-scale blackouts, the number of emergency plans is huge. Each process strongly relies on experienced decision-making. The intelligentization of emergency plan execution needs to be improved. This paper studies the automatic reasoning response method in the process of emergency plan implementation and disposal. Furthermore it proposes a construction method of knowledge database and knowledge graph of power grid emergency plan, as well as the pattern matching method and relationship matching model of power grid emergency plan reasoning. Reasoning and application of some main responsibilities in typical disaster response are discussed. The research results provide theoretical support for the improvement of the implementation efficiency of each process of the power grid emergency plan.
